Operating Budget Addenda (in order of greatest impact)
•
Increase Funding for Involuntary Mental Health Commitments
Decision Package
Transfers $34,920 of existing general fund appropriation from the Criminal Fund to cover the additional costs for mental health evaluation and care related to the involuntary commitment of indigent persons.
